diff --git a/libs/main/core/pibase.h b/libs/main/core/pibase.h index 832ea872..c8eff9d8 100644 --- a/libs/main/core/pibase.h +++ b/libs/main/core/pibase.h @@ -194,6 +194,16 @@ //! \~russian Макрос для окончания статической инициализации # define STATIC_INITIALIZER_END +//! \~\brief +//! \~english Macro to remove class copy availability +//! \~russian Макрос для запрета копирования класса +# define NO_COPY_CLASS(Class) + +//! \~\brief +//! \~english Macro to supress compiler warning about unused variable +//! \~russian Макрос для подавления предупреждения компилятора о неиспользуемой переменной +# define NO_UNUSED(x) + #undef MICRO_PIP #undef FREERTOS #endif //DOXYGEN diff --git a/libs/main/system/pisignals.h b/libs/main/system/pisignals.h index d93fa694..8463bbe7 100644 --- a/libs/main/system/pisignals.h +++ b/libs/main/system/pisignals.h @@ -27,6 +27,7 @@ #define PISIGNALS_H #include "piflags.h" +#include class PIP_EXPORT PISignals {